Love Finds You: Cast, Filming Location and How to Watch

Hallmark Channel is leaning into romance, mystery, and a touch of delivery-service destiny with Love Finds You, the new movie pairing fan favorites Aimee Teegarden and Chris McNally. Premiering on August 22, the charming original follows a jewelry designer whose life takes an unexpected turn after a mislabeled package makes her believe fate may have delivered her perfect match.

But the real surprise may be the connection she forms while searching for him.

A Mislabeled Package Sets Off a Big Romantic Adventure

Love Finds You takes a simple everyday mishap and turns it into a citywide quest for love. The premise is exactly the kind of playful, warm-hearted setup Hallmark viewers adore: a package arrives at the wrong address, a hopeful romantic reads it as a sign, and a stranger becomes an essential part of the search.

Aimee Teegarden stars as Alex, a talented jewelry designer who becomes convinced that a package intended for someone else may be proof that she has somehow found her ideal man. Rather than shrugging off the strange delivery, Alex chooses to follow the clue wherever it leads.

Alex and Jack Are at the Center of the Story

Chris McNally plays Jack, the delivery driver who gets pulled into Alex’s increasingly personal mission. What begins as an effort to locate the intended recipient soon becomes something far more meaningful, as the pair travels across the city and discovers that their search is revealing truths about their own lives.

The official setup makes it clear that Alex and Jack aren’t merely chasing a misplaced parcel. They’re also figuring out what they truly want from romance, work, and the unexpected possibilities that arrive when life refuses to go according to plan.

It’s a classic Hallmark emotional journey, but the package mystery gives the story an extra hook. For viewers who love a slow-burn connection, the film appears built around the fun contrast between Alex’s belief in destiny and Jack’s role as the practical person trying to solve a logistical problem.

Naturally, spending a day navigating the city together has a way of changing both of their perspectives.

Aimee Teegarden Brings Hallmark Experience to Alex

Teegarden has long been a familiar and welcome face for television audiences. She is perhaps best known for her role as Julie Taylor on the acclaimed drama Friday Night Lights, where she played the daughter of Coach Eric and Tami Taylor.

That performance helped introduce her to a generation of viewers and remains one of the defining roles of her career.

Over the years, Teegarden has built an impressive list of screen credits spanning dramas, thrillers, teen films, and romantic projects. Her past work includes Notorious, The Ranch, The Rookie, Rings, Scream 4, Prom, and Star-Crossed.

Her Hallmark Resume Is Already Packed With Fan Favorites

Teegarden is no stranger to uplifting romance stories. Before stepping into Alex’s shoes, she appeared in several Hallmark projects, including My Christmas Family Tree, A New Year’s Resolution, and Once Upon a Christmas Miracle.

Her return to the network gives Love Finds You an immediate sense of comfort for longtime fans.

Alex sounds like a role designed for Teegarden’s strengths. She gets to play a creative professional with an open heart, a willingness to take a chance, and enough determination to turn a delivery error into an all-day mission.

Chris McNally Makes This a Must-Watch for Hallmark Fans

McNally has become one of Hallmark Channel’s most recognizable leading men, thanks in large part to his ongoing role in When Calls the Heart. Since joining the beloved series in 2019, he has built a deeply loyal audience that follows his work well beyond Hope Valley.

His casting as Jack gives Love Finds You an appealing energy. A delivery driver may sound like an ordinary job on paper, but in a Hallmark romance, the man behind the wheel is often exactly the person who arrives at the right moment.

Jack’s involvement in Alex’s quest puts him in a perfect position to become much more than a helpful stranger.

McNally Has a Long History With Romantic and Dramatic Television

Outside of Hallmark, McNally has appeared in a wide range of popular television series, including Lucifer, Killer Instinct, Supernatural, Riverdale, Firefly Lane, and Falling Skies. His varied career has allowed him to play characters across multiple genres, from supernatural drama to contemporary romance.

His Hallmark credits include A Tail of Love, A Winter Princess, Sailing Into Love, The Sweetest Heart, and Eat, Drink & Be Buried: A Gourmet Detective Mystery.

With that resume, McNally knows how to balance humor, sincerity, and the swoony moments that make viewers eager for the final act.

The Filming Location May Look Familiar to Movie Lovers

Although Love Finds You is designed as a citywide romantic adventure, the movie was reportedly filmed in Burnaby, British Columbia, Canada. The production was filmed under the working title Return to Sender, a clever hint at the package-centered story driving Alex and Jack’s journey.

The official production listing from UBCP/ACTRA identifies Burnaby as the filming location. The British Columbia city has become a major destination for film and television productions, particularly projects that need a flexible urban environment without requiring an enormous production footprint.

Burnaby Offers the Right Mix of City Energy and Cozy Corners

Burnaby can easily provide the varied look a story like this requires. The area includes high-rise commercial spaces, older shopping streets, residential neighborhoods, and smaller business districts.

That means the production could create the feeling of a wide-ranging city search while keeping filming locations relatively close together.

For Love Finds You, that variety is especially important. Alex and Jack need places to investigate, people to encounter, and enough visual movement to make the hunt for the mystery man feel like a genuine adventure.

The setting can shift from bustling streets to quieter corners, giving their growing relationship plenty of room to unfold.

How to Watch Love Finds You After Its Premiere

Love Finds You premiered on Hallmark Channel on Saturday, August 22, at 8 p.m. ET. If you missed the first showing, there are multiple opportunities to catch up with Alex, Jack, and the package that changes everything.

The movie begins streaming on Hallmark+ on Sunday, August 23, making it an easy addition to a late-summer movie night. Hallmark Channel has also scheduled several repeat airings for viewers who still prefer watching on traditional television.
